+ /**
+ * Fire the queued action events.
+ * In the coalescing mode, a single event is fired as a replacement
+ * for all queued events. In non coalescing mode, a series of
+ * all queued events is fired.
+ * This is package-private to avoid an accessor method.
+ */
+ void drainEvents()
+ {
+ synchronized (queueLock)
+ {
+ if (isCoalesce())
+ {
+ if (queue > 0)
+ fireActionPerformed();
+ }
+ else
+ {
+ while (queue > 0)
+ {
+ fireActionPerformed();
+ queue--;
+ }
+ }
+ queue = 0;
+ }
+ }
